Suitable Shoes
Whether you’re taking a brisk walk on flat ground or wanting to be adventurous and conquer miles and heights, if your shoes aren’t right, your body won’t either. You always want to think about your feet, ankles, knees, and hips as you walk. Hiking boots, sneakers and sandals custom made for your “hiking” are ideal and the best way to go! Everyone is different in how their bodies respond to natural elements. Some hikers prefer a vest, while others prefer a good hiking jacket.
